Addictive Drums 2 Crashing Platinum

For some reason, Additive Drums is crashing Platinum. I can’t figure out why. I have not always had this problem. One day, I got a red banner saying my “trial time” was up for Additive Drums. Hum. B.S. Then it would just crash. I have attempted all the remedies that have already been discussed here. Running as Admin, reinstalling AD and I even changed the compatibility to WIN 8. I then got the computer id error.When (in the millionth try) it would load, it will crash in the middle of a session which makes the issue MORE frustrating, then it wouldn’t load again and crash that application.
 
Now, I’ve noticed that when I attempt to load AD, there is a window at the top that says “processing tracks,” then a prompt comes up and says “SONARPLT.exe has stopped working.” Noticing this, I tried a new approach. In Platinum, if you select “New Project,” it loads automatically with an audio and MIDI track. So, I decided to DELETE those tracks and try to install AD. Wow, it worked and loaded AD! Was that the issue??? I attempted the same approach again…nope, it crashed.
 
Here is the real funny part. I bought Cakewalk’s Home Studio, loads up just fine. No issue and works as long as I need it too.
I can’t believe I’m the only one who is having this issue, either that, or no one is using AD for their projects. Seeing that others have encountered this and seemingly resolved this gives me both hope and confusion. I don’t believe its an issue with WIN 10 or my computer and I have 12GB of RAM. It seems to me there is an issue with how Platinum is managing memory for AD. I have no issues with any other plugins.
 
Any ideas or help would be great. I wouldn’t mind hearing from the application engineers about this issue.
 
Intel i5 as 2.67Ghz,
12 GB RAM,
WIN 10 64bit
